Programme Overview
The Postgraduate Certificate in Fracture Network Analysis and Simulation is designed for professionals and researchers in geology, engineering, and related fields who seek to deepen their understanding of fracture mechanics and their applications in geomechanical modeling. This program provides a comprehensive study of fracture network analysis and simulation techniques, focusing on both theoretical foundations and practical applications in reservoir engineering, mining, and environmental geology. Learners will explore advanced analytical methods, computational techniques, and experimental approaches to assess and predict the behavior of fracture networks in various geological contexts.
Key skills and knowledge developed through this program include the ability to apply fracture mechanics principles to analyze complex geological structures, use specialized software for simulating fracture behavior, and interpret geophysical data to characterize fracture networks. Students will also gain proficiency in data analysis, statistical modeling, and the integration of multiple datasets to enhance decision-making processes in geomechanical applications. By the end of the program, learners will be equipped to contribute effectively to multidisciplinary projects involving the assessment of structural integrity in natural resources and infrastructure.
